Outline of Final Research Achievements

Firstly, I have made a corpus of bronze mirrors made or imported in Yayoi and Kofun period. This corpus exceeeds old ones in quality, quantity and accuracy.
I carried out the study from a multidirectional viewpoint based on the corpus, such as an historical study on domestic mirrors in Kofun period, circulation and possession of bronze mirrors in the period, process of the appearance of domestic mirrors, statistical analysis of bronze mirrors, correlation of mirrors and human bones in burials, general analysis of bronze mirrors from documentation and archaeological date, and so on.
Through the study, I presented a lot of important viewpoints on the study of ancient bronze mirrors of Kofun period in Japanese archipelago.
